Anders is a mage who has escaped from the Circle of Magi and is a potential companion in Dragon Age: Origins - Awakening. Despite his distinct dislike for the Circle, he has a rather laid-back and care-free attitude and doesn't let dire circumstances get him down. He is also a companion and potential love interest[1] to Hawke in Dragon Age II.
Background
As an adolescent he was taken to the Circle Tower by the templars, which he despised as he compared it to a prison. He's a very talented mage and has escaped from the tower seven times, only to be captured and brought back by the templars. Despite accusations that he is a maleficar, he is only an apostate and wants nothing more than to be free.
Involvement
Dragon Age: Origins - Awakening
Anders is found during the opening quest to regain Vigil's Keep. He has killed many darkspawn and is surrounded by dead templars. He claims to have not killed the templars although there is no proof either way. The Warden-Commander can then ask him to join the group and he will do so. Alternatively, the Warden can let him escape at that point and still have a chance to recruit him later on the rooftop of Vigil's Keep. He will be found spying on the Withered and Seneschal Varel, at which point he'll warn the Warden about the danger that lies ahead and confess that he came back because he wanted to help defend people against the darkspawn.
After the opening quest is completed, Rylock, a templar, will warrant Anders' arrest. The Warden-Commander can either conscript him, therefore making him undergo the Joining Ritual, or allow his arrest with or without leniency. If conscripted, he will survive the ritual and become a Grey Warden. During his companion quest, another choice will have to be made to either side with him, or let the templars take him into custody.
Epilogue
- If left to defend the Keep, Anders will be hailed a hero by the few survivors of Vigil's Keep by using his magic to hold off hundreds of darkspawn. He gets invited by the men to engage in a drinking contest. He loses.
- Anders will remain with the Grey Wardens to train the Order's next generation of mages. When he is called by the Circle of Magi to deliver a lecture on the nature of the Architect - much to the templars' dismay -, he tells the Commander of the Grey that his time with the Order is over. However, not two months later, he returns and the Wardens remain his home and lasting companions.
- If Anders' companion quest is not complete, he will be captured again when he resigns from the Wardens. With his phylactery secure, he is unable to evade the templars. After two subsequent escape attempts, he vanishes for a third and final time.
- If left to defend the Keep without enough upgrades to it, he is found dead with an arrow through his neck with hundreds of darkspawn dead in a circle around him; none were touched with a blade, but all were felled by magic.
- No longer a part of the Wardens, the Chantry brands him an apostate, but never captures him. He is last seen on a pirate ship with a familiar woman. This possibly references the companion Isabela in Dragon Age II.
Dragon Age II
Despite the various epilogues of Awakening, Anders left the Wardens to live in Kirkwall, where he uses his healing abilities to aid refugees in the city. Anders is one of the first party members you can recruit. [2]
When he meets Hawke for the first time, they head off to rescue a friend of Anders from the Templars. Upon arriving, they discover the friend has been made Tranquil and then in his anger, Anders unleashes a Spirit of Justice.
The spirit is Justice from Awakening. Anders agrees to be Justice's host. However, the anger Anders has towards the Circle of Magi warps Justice into a demon of Vengeance. Now Anders must struggle mentally and physically to maintain his control[3].
Anders mentions Ser Pounce-a-lot if given to him in Awakening. He says that the Wardens forced him to give the cat to a friend in Amaranthine after it almost got him torn in half during a Deep Roads expedition. The Wardens claimed it "made him too soft." [4].

Plot skills (Dragon Age: Origins - Awakening)
As you befriend Anders and gain his approval, he will gain additional skills:
Skill Name | Benefit | Requirement |
---|---|---|
Inspired: Minor Willpower | +1 to Willpower | 25% approval |
Inspired: Moderate Willpower | +2 to Willpower | 50% approval |
Inspired: Major Willpower | +4 to Willpower | 75% approval |
Inspired: Massive Willpower | +6 to Willpower | 90% approval |
Dialogue points (Dragon Age: Origins - Awakening)
Below are the spots where you can initiate dialogue with Anders. On the PC, it can be hard to find the correct spot to click; make sure to hit "tab" and rotate the camera if it's not letting you click on it.
- Vigil's Keep: The statue of Andraste in the middle of the courtyard
- Kal'Hirol - Trade Quarter: A basket of lyrium at the far end of the forge area (where the repair anvil is)
- City of Amaranthine: A pine tree on the left side of the path just before the first gate

Trivia
- Greg Ellis also voices Cullen, a templar.
- Anders seems to have the same hairstyle and earring as Duncan.
- He bears a striking resemblance to Alistair, both in appearance and personality wise. (However, Bioware's David Gaider has confirmed there is no relation.)
- Though he uses a fire spell when you first meet him, he does not have the spell when he joins your party.
- If Anders specializes in Blood Magic, the player can have another additional line of dialogue with Anders when speaking about Anders' past with the templars. When Anders remarks there really isn't much of a reason to arrest him, the Warden can point out that Anders is an actual blood mage now, to which Anders will laugh.
- Anders is a common name in Scandinavia, equivalent to the English name Andrew, and derived from the Ancient Greek word andros, meaning "human" or "man". In modern Dutch and modern German anders means "different".
- The name Anders is mentioned in Mass Effect 2, another game by Bioware, as an officer on the Hugo Gernsback.
- Anders is mentioned by Finn in the Witch Hunt DLC, in a regular conversation.
- In the library in the Circle of Magi during the Witch Hunt DLC one can find some old notes left in a book in which a young mage made sketches in the margins of Templars being eaten by a tiger named "Ser Pounce-a-lot". (Since that mage is Anders, he subsequently names the kitten given to him in Awakening Ser Pounce-a-lot.)
- In the Witch Hunt DLC, the mage Finn reveals through dialogue that Anders once escaped the Circle of Magi by swimming across Lake Calenhad during a weekly training exercise for the apprentices. He was caught again one week later.
- David Gaider was the original writer for Anders in Awakening, but Jennifer Hepler took over the role for Dragon Age II.
- Jennifer Hepler describes DA2's Anders as being definitely still recognizable as the snarky ol' Anders on most subjects. He/Justice just have one enormous blind spot. And the bigger that issue gets in the world, the harder it is for Anders to focus on anything else. [6]
